Figure 5. Anti-ADAMTS13 IgGs in murine plasma. Murine plasmas (1:10) obtained from wild-type mice (WT1-WT4), Adamts13−/− mice transplanted with HPCs expressing GFP alone (O1-O4 and R1-R3) and GFP-ADAMTS13 (N1-N3 and P1-P4) at 3 months were incubated with immobilized purified murine ADAMTS13 on a microtiter plate. The bound IgG was detected by HRP-conjugated anti–mouse IgG as described in “Assay for murine plasma anti-ADAMTS13 IgG.” The positive control was serum (1:10 000 to 80 000) from a rabbit immunized with purified murine and human ADAMTS13 proteins (Anti-mAD13) according to the standard protocol. Negative control was negative in the wells with no ADAMTS13 immobilized despite of an incubation with rabbit anti-mAD13 serum (1:10 000) or murine plasma (1:10).
